**Short answer:** The clean between two stays. In Lemon a turnover is a checkout cleaning job created for every guest checkout, scheduled at the property's checkout time (default 11:00) and expected to finish before the next check-in (default 15:00). A same-day turnover is when both fall on the same date.

Turnovers are the unit of work Lemon exists to schedule. Each one carries the property, the scheduled date and time, the job type (`checkout`, `mid_stay` or `manual`), an urgency, the assigned cleaner, the checklist and photo areas, and a timeline: offered, confirmed, started (optionally with a GPS check), photos submitted, completed. 506 of the 533 jobs Lemon has created since February 2026 are checkout turnovers; the median takes 93 minutes.

A turnover is also the unit the calendar engine protects. Every guard in the sync — re-key adoption, the forward-trim pin, the merged-block rules, the imminent window — exists so that a turnover that is real keeps its cleaner and a turnover that is not does not send one. The average stay on Lemon's estate is 4.8 nights, so a property sees roughly six turnovers a month in season.
